## Configuration

Plugins that extend the Hollowmere profile store must respect its shard layout. In your plugin's .env, set SHARD_RING_SIZE to the value published by the host, and SHARD_KEY_FIELD to the attribute you hash on (default: profile handle). Range-based strategies are unsupported; the router assumes consistent hashing. Plugins register with the coordinator at startup and are rejected if ring sizes disagree. Place your coordinator access secret on the line that follows these settings.

sealed setting: RELAY_SECRET5=82864

Handover: GridForge export service. The XLSX exporter buffers whole sheets in memory; anything over ~200k rows spikes the heap and the pod gets OOM-killed. Short-term fix was raising limits — don't touch that. Real fix is streaming row writes, half-done on branch export-stream. Tests pass except the pivot cases. Talk to Marisol on the Telva team before changing the serializer; she owns the format quirks. Profiling captures and the memory budget spreadsheet are on the internal page here.

wiki page, bagaf-fawip: https://harbor.tolvaqsys.local/pages/repo/pages/secrets/eac969ffc71f356b

## Environment Variables — Cron Migration

As part of moving the nightly cron jobs at Tindervale Systems into the Loomwork workflow engine, each job's schedule now lives in the engine, not crontab. The migrated workers read their settings from a shared .env file. Loomwork's API requires an access credential per worker, set on the next line.

vault entry, yahif-yajep: COURIER_KEY29=b802bdf8034096b65a51c6ba5abe2

To: Regional Sales Leads

After careful assessment of utilization data and lease terms, we will close the Ashpool satellite office at the end of next quarter. All four staff have been offered remote arrangements or relocation to the Dunmere hub; none will be made redundant. Client meetings previously hosted at Ashpool should move to Dunmere or virtual formats. Territory coverage is unchanged.

Please handle this discreetly until the all-hands. The broader planning context appears in the note below.

confidential, bahof-yaweg: Headcount on the Kaseth team goes from 32 to 109 by the end of January. Gross margin on Kaseth came in at 46 percent against a plan of 45 percent.